Regulation of expression of the multidrug resistance-associated protein 2 (MRP2) and its role in drug disposition.
The Journal of pharmacology and experimental therapeutics - 1 Aug 2002
Gerk Phillip M, Vore Mary
Abstract excerpt
The multidrug resistance protein 2 (MRP2; ABCC2) is an ATP-binding cassette transporter accepting a diverse range of substrates, including glutathione, glucuronide, and sulfate conjugates of many endo- and xenobiotics. MRP2 generally performs excretory or protective roles, and it is expressed on...
